Spokane, WA – Wallace Idaho
Wallace is a fine example of an old mining town and during its heyday, used to be the center of a lead, silver, and gold mining in this part of t he state. Even President Teddy Roosevelt visited in 1903 and the city spent over $5000 on decorations and banners to welcome him. At the time that was a lot of money.
